‘Godfather of Russian internet’ dies, aged 51

-

Anton Nossik, an entreprene­ur and blogger known as the “godfather of the Russian internet” died yesterday.

The Russian-israeli citizen, a prominent critic of Kremlin efforts to curtail web freedom, died of a heart attack at the age of 51.

In 2016, Nossik was convicted by a Moscow court of making public calls for extremism over a 2015 post on his blog in which he said Syria should be “wiped off the face of the Earth” because it threatens Israel.
